Pinch-flats are virtually eliminated allowing for a 30% air pressure reduction versus a standard clincher wheelset. With lower-profile, less vulnerable sidewalls, BST rims are also lighter and stronger by design, and accelerate more quickly. The result is more traction and less rolling resistance. BST rims secure the bead of the tire, not the sidewall, creating an air-tight seal while allowing the tire's sidewall to expand to its true, rounder, more effective profile. Bead Socket Technology rims are designed to match the shape of the tire's bead to create a safer and more air-tight interface. The Iron Cross Pro features Stan's trademark Bead Socket Technology (BST) featuring low profile beadhooks. The 20mm internal rim width provides superior tire performance and the stability necessary for wider cyclocross tires. As a dedicated 'cross wheelset, the width of the Iron Cross rim means it's optimized for common width cyclocross tires. The Iron Cross disc rims are designed for superior burp resistance with low pressure tube-type cyclocross clinchers. The Rear 3.30RD hub is 11-speed compatible and also offered in a Campagnolo compatible version. The Comp offers the added durability and resilience of 32 spokes front and rear to handle the wattage of torque of the most powerful riders. The Iron Cross Comp Wheelset is 1590g complete with our 3.30 disc hubs. Step up to a true performance 'cross wheelset with our Iron Cross Comp.
